Transaction 7ab76ab763e95ff1b63cd1c7218a9e64ddc3a697d6ecd17b9f76fb2008479791

1 Input
2 Outputs
  • 7ab76ab763e95ff1b63cd1c7218a9e64ddc3a697d6ecd17b9f76fb2008479791:0
  • value  1951571699
    address  19MwcsRPS1aJRYM2jzoncNapH6DoeagYgi
  • 7ab76ab763e95ff1b63cd1c7218a9e64ddc3a697d6ecd17b9f76fb2008479791:1
  • value  1354407
    address  1JhKhdQiAA6f3nRMyE6SNxmGDLKioB1aWQ